SUMMARY:Network Cork March 2021: The Branding of Me
DESCRIPTION:The importance of understanding who we are and what we stand for - our Brand Message. Join Network Cork on March 31st to explore 'The Branding of Me'. Guest speaker Maeve Ahern O'Neill\, lecturer and personal branding consultant\, will discuss:\n\n\n	\n	How important it is to understand who we are and what we stand for - our brand message\;\n	\n	\n	How to empower ourselves with this message\;\n	\n	\n	And how we can market this message to our customers through personal branding and online platforms.\n	\n\n\nWhether you are preparing your strategic business plan or developing your online platforms\, this advice will also be relevant if putting yourself forward for the Network Ireland Cork Branch annual awards.\n\nMC for the evening is Gillian McGrath from Change\, Grow\, Succeed who will interview a panel of guests regarding the Awards application and deadline. Awards Judges\, Sharon Corcoran\, Director of Service for Economic Enterprise & Tourism Development at Cork County Council and Ernest Cantillon\, Director at Kinsale Spirit Co will be on hand with advice from the judges' perspective and Maria Desmond\, Enable Ireland\, this year's Awards Coordinator will outline the categories and give up to date feedback on this year's process.\n\nAs with all of our online Zoom events\, Network Cork will operate 'breakout rooms' so that you can network and mingle in small groups so be sure to introduce yourself and your business and connect via LinkedIn after the event. New guests are always welcome. If you have any questions for our speakers\, download the app 'Slido' and enter code #networkcork.\n\nMore about the speaker:\n\nMaeve Ahern O'Neill established The Branding of Me in 2015 after the completion of her research on personal branding on social media for her Master's Degree. Since then\, Maeve's clients have been third-level colleges\, multi-national companies\, start-up businesses\, and individuals. Her vision is to empower the people behind the business with the skills and confidence with their personal brand. Maeve continued with her research into visual-based digital communication and in 2020 became a lecturer of marketing and management in Griffith College Cork.
